SOUTHERN PETRO 2022-23 Annual Report Analysis
Mon, 26 Feb

SOUTHERN PETRO has announced its results for the year ended March 2023. Let us have a look at the detailed performance review of the company during FY22-23.

SOUTHERN PETRO Income Statement Analysis

  • Operating income during the year rose 50.9% on a year-on-year (YoY) basis.
  • The company's operating profit increased by 74.0% YoY during the fiscal. Operating profit margins witnessed a fall and down at 13.3% in FY23 as against 11.5% in FY22.
  • Depreciation charges decreased by 1.5% and finance costs increased by 117.9% YoY, respectively.
  • Other income grew by 24.1% YoY.
  • Net profit for the year grew by 84.1% YoY.
  • Net profit margins during the year grew from 8.7% in FY22 to 10.6% in FY23.

SOUTHERN PETRO Balance Sheet Analysis

  • The company's current liabilities during FY23 stood at Rs 11 billion as compared to Rs 9 billion in FY22, thereby witnessing an increase of 20.1%.
  • Long-term debt stood at Rs 1 billion as compared to Rs 374 million during FY22, a growth of 171.0%.
  • Current assets rose 73% and stood at Rs 12 billion, while fixed assets rose 8% and stood at Rs 10 billion in FY23.
  • Overall, the total assets and liabilities for FY23 stood at Rs 21 billion as against Rs 16 billion during FY22, thereby witnessing a growth of 35%.

Ratio Analysis for SOUTHERN PETRO

  • Solvency Ratios
  • Current Ratio: The company's current ratio improved and stood at 1.0x during FY23, from 0.7x during FY22. The current ratio measures the company's ability to pay short-term and long-term obligations.

    Interest Coverage Ratio: The company's interest coverage ratio deteriorated and stood at 11.4x during FY23, from 13.2x during FY22. The interest coverage ratio of a company states how easily a company can pay its interest expense on outstanding debt. A higher ratio is preferable.

  • Profitability Ratios
  • Return on Equity (ROE): The ROE for the company improved and stood at 30.5% during FY23, from 23.5% during FY23. The ROE measures the ability of a firm to generate profits from its shareholders capital in the company.

    Return on Capital Employed (ROCE): The ROCE for the company improved and stood at 32.4% during FY23, from 25.7% during FY22. The ROCE measures the ability of a firm to generate profits from its total capital (shareholder capital plus debt capital) employed in the company.

    Return on Assets (ROA): The ROA of the company improved and stood at 15.4% during FY23, from 11.2% during FY22. The ROA measures how efficiently the company uses its assets to generate earnings.

What was the revenue of SOUTHERN PETRO in FY23? How does it compare to earlier years?

The revenues of SOUTHERN PETRO stood at Rs 28,494 m in FY23, which was up 50.6% compared to Rs 18,915 m reported in FY22.

SOUTHERN PETRO's revenue has fallen from Rs 31,765 m in FY19 to Rs 28,494 m in FY23.

Over the past 5 years, the revenue of SOUTHERN PETRO has grown at a CAGR of -2.7%.

What was the net profit of SOUTHERN PETRO in FY23? How does it compare to earlier years?

The net profit of SOUTHERN PETRO stood at Rs 3,007 m in FY23, which was up 84.1% compared to Rs 1,633 m reported in FY22.

This compares to a net profit of Rs 741 m in FY21 and a net profit of Rs 543 m in FY20.

Over the past 5 years, SOUTHERN PETRO net profit has grown at a CAGR of 56.3%.
